Security Engineer
Accenture Federal ServicesAbout the role
Job Description:
AFS is looking for an experienced Security Engineer to join our team.
Responsibilities:
- Apply Information Assurance and certification and accreditation skills to assess, audit, guide, consult, analyze, investigate, and protect enterprise systems, applications, data, assets, and people.
- Provide services to the customer to safeguard information, infrastructures, applications, and business processes against cyber threats, per JSIG requirements
Here is what you need:
- 5+ years of experience as an ISSO/SCA and/or ISSE
- 5+ years of experience supporting DoD and Intel Community
- CISSP or 8570 IAM level 3 required.
Bonus points if you have:
- Experience with Assured File Transfer (AFT) process. Adept with DoD Risk Management Framework (RMF) steps and capable of leading RMF Assessment & Authorization (A&A) of IT networks.
- Familiar with CNSSI 1253, SP 800-53, DoD 8500 series, STIG settings, Continuous Monitoring (ConMon) procedures with ACAS, configuring ACAS dashboards.
- Strong communication skills.
- Past experience leading Incident Response (IR) procedures from incident discovery to investigation conclusion. Ability to schedule and lead meetings, document actions, and follow-up meetings with action-items email.
- Experience with eMASS, and Xacta preferred.
Security Clearance:
Active TS/SCI required to start
